#3e6040 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#3e6040 is composed of 24.3% red, 37.6% green and 25.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 35.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 33.3% yellow and 62.4% black. It has a hue angle of 123.5 degrees, a saturation of 21.5% and a lightness of 31%. #3e6040 color hex could be obtained by blending #7cc080 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

● #3e6040 color description : Very dark desaturated lime green.
#3e6040 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#3e6040 has RGB values of R:62, G:96, B:64 and CMYK values of C:0.35, M:0, Y:0.33, K:0.62. Its decimal value is 4087872.
